### Changelog — Ovenline v3.4

Rotated signing credentials after moving the Crumbport bakery order-cutoff rule from 14:00 to 12:30 local. Orders placed after cutoff now queue for next-day batches automatically. The old key is revoked effective this release; update your verification config to use the key below.

deploy key for hawef-bafog: bky13_1N9K4SjjejvXh

**Vendor note: Inkmill markdown pipeline**

Rendering for Parchway docs is outsourced to Inkmill under an annual contract, renewing each March. They handle sanitization and PDF export; we own the upload queue. SLA: 4-hour response on rendering failures. Escalate only after two failed retries. Their support desk is reachable at the address below.

billing contact of hahaf-baguf = zorael.tammir.jorius@sivrelhq.internal

On-call: we're seeing non-deterministic row ordering in scheduled exports from the Harlowe tenant since Thursday's deploy. The report builder's stable-sort flag appears enabled in the repo manifest but disabled on two of the four production workers, so identical reports render with different row sequences depending on which worker serves the job. No deploy touched those workers directly, which points to configuration drift rather than a code regression. The values currently live on the drifted workers are reproduced below.

service settings:
PRAIX_LOG_LEVEL=error
PRAIX_METRICS_HOST=metrics.praix.qorvelcorp.corp
PRAIX_POOL_SIZE=16

# Build Provenance: Glintwork UI Snapshots

Snapshot tests for Glintwork components are only trustworthy if you know exactly which build produced the baselines. Each baseline set is generated in a clean container, never on a laptop, and the generating pipeline records its inputs. As a contractor, please verify baselines against the recorded build before approving diffs. The provenance token for the current baseline set appears below.

pipeline stamp: htk31_f769b577b3028a4e9958e5bb8d1259a